Tips On Picking The Best Walk In Cooler

August 4th, 2010 | No Comments | Posted in Food and Drink

You may discover walk in cooler of different sorts and types. I will recommend a walk in cooler with a combo box with both freezer and cooler compartments. As you may have heard, one of the simplest ways to thaw food products is by putting it in a cooler first after you’ve taken it out of the freezer. To make sure that hot air coming from the kitchen area does not go into the freezer, the freezer comes with its own door. The standard for freezers is to have three inches of insulation. Most walk in freezers go above and beyond this standard by utilizing 4 inches of insulation rather than just 3.

Regular galvanized steel was the standard set by the National Sanitation Foundation in the past, but then they now modified it to steel flooring that are more sturdy and expensive. The problem with galvanized flooring is that they tend to rust and dent when they age. Needless to say we don’t want meat kept within such unhygienic conditions. Carts and shelves are rolled on the flooring every so often and this will cause the flooring to sooner or later warp and bent. Steel flooring are more durable and decrease the likelihood of warping. Stainless steel also doesn’t rust.

Some units include flooring while a few do not. There is likely to be a little thermal loss with floorless walk in coolers though. A lot of vendors would attempt to offer the walk in coolers with the 4 inch ground slabs as the floors make up about 20% TO 25% of the sale value. Eliminating the floor will take 1 / 4 off the profits from vendors. Floorless coolers could be less energy efficient as it could take more power and electricity to even out the temperature. So, it might seem more cheap to buy a floorless walk in cooler in the beginning however you could end up spending more on electricity afterward.

Other knowledgeable consumers also choose to purchase coolers that have rigid foam building insulation because these are much more inexpensive than coolers that have built in flooring insulation. Thick set quarry tiles can be positioned on top of the insulation. And, on top of that, you may also put seamless vinyl safety flooring materials just like Altro or Multi-Tech epoxy tiles. To strengthen the floors more, you could use boards which are waterproof like Homasote, Durock and Den-Shield.

Selecting the right type of floors for your walk in coolers may be a little costly however it’s going to also offer some safety by eliminating steep, slippery ramps and allow racks and shelves to roll smoothly. This would make sure that food on trays or shelves won’t accidentally spill in the freezer or all over floors of the cooler.

Ideas On Exactly How One Could Make Use Of Coffee Cups For Everyday Use, Gifts And Marketing

August 1st, 2010 | No Comments | Posted in Coffee

Coffee mugs and cups are one of the most versatile items found in everyone’s kitchen cupboards. They come in all shapes and sizes, with different styles imprinted on them. They can hold candy, milk, water, tea and of course, coffee. The price of coffee mugs can be variable; they can be less than a dollar or up to twenty or more dollars. They can be used as a daily coffee cup, a birthday present, Christmas present or even a gag gift. In addition, the way coffee is manufactured has become very versatile in recent years, making it a convenient way to get some coffee on the go.

Different Styles Available

Coffee mugs come in assorted styles. For those who do not have time to stop and smell the coffee, there are travel mugs. At the same time, paper cups are utilized in coffee shops and stores that sell coffee drinks for customers to take their drink to go; custom cups are for anyone who drinks coffee, these usually have a picture or saying that suites the one who owns it; special coffee cups are for those who enjoy entertaining guests with coffee or tea.

An Inexpensive Way to Market Your Company

More and more corporations are utilizing the cost effective marketing that coffee cups provide. When a company offers free mugs to customers, it is a great marketing tool. Each company can find a promotional cup that would suit their budget and style.

Any Presents

These inexpensive coffee mugs can be used for all types of gifts, whether the fancy, thoughtful holiday present or ugly, corny, gaudy gag gift, they make the perfect present. With the styles available, they are sure leave an impression at any event.

Convenience

The way coffee mugs are used has changed in recent years. What used to be a typical coffee pot, is now available in single cup coffee pots, espresso makers and drive through coffee shops. The invention of all these items has brought the morning cup of coffee back from isolation. What used to take a long time to do, now take mere minutes, making it much more accessible for those busy people who do not have the time to stop and make their morning cup of coffee.

Why Fish And Chips Is Considered To Be A Favorite Takeaway Snack

July 31st, 2010 | No Comments | Posted in business

There’s no denying it, fish and chips is one of the most identifiable and most ordered snacks all over the world. It has been part of the takeout food group for as long as we know, and has always been a favorite choice along with the ever dependable burgers. The tasty deep fried fish that is as tender in the inside as it is crunchy on the outside and its every bit as tempting chips are just exactly what makes it irresistible.

It’s hard to track down the precise beginning of fish and chips, although the U.K. boasts to have been the first one to marry fish and chips together. It’s been said that Joseph Malin of London was the first to sell the two as one in 1860. Fried fish was already being sold in the city before that time, and chips already got its reputation as being a fast food product. Malin was said to be the one who joined the two delicious treats together, thereby giving birth to a whole new specialty that is still present today.

The dish became a favorite in London and the whole of England. Not only that, it also spread to its neighboring nations, Scotland and Ireland, as well as then British colonies Australia and New Zealand. Today, fish and chips is all over, from the U.S. and Canada to even some Asian countries.

But what exactly is fish and chips? Why do people keep declaring that chips are better with fish than with the more popular burger?

Fish in this case is made of deep-fried fish, usually, cod or haddock, that is coated in a crispy batter and served with big pieces of fried potatoes. They are traditionally covered in a newspaper. In the U.K., they are served with salt and vinegar, while other areas of the world serve it with tartar sauce and chicken salt or tomato sauce and lemon slices.

The chips used here are also chopped chunkier and cooked longer than the more famous French fries. Burgers can rest assured that fries will remain with them, while chips will remain with fish.

Fish and chips continues to be an important part of fast food history. It has been a popular takeout snack since it was first served to the public. There is no doubt that it will continue to be that way.
